PTOLEMAIC KINGS of EGYPT. Ptolemy II. 285-246 BC. AR Tetradrachm (27mm, 14.03 gm). Alexandria mint. Countermarked for
THRACE, Byzantion. Diademed head of Ptolemy I right, wearing aegis; c/m: monogram incuse on neck / Eagle standing left on thunderbolt; monogram above shield in left field; P between legs. For coin: Svoronos 591; SNG Copenhagen 112. For c/m: Svoronos 365
h. Toned, nice VF, banker's mark on obverse.
